Exporting animated scene ORBX to cloud Issue

PostPosted: Wed Feb 07, 2018 9:58 pm
by mrpinoux
Hi All,

I Exported an animated scene with camera move, and material with a targa sequence, with ORBX to the stand alone. It works great.
Then, I'm sending it to the cloud and it gives me an issue and this message :

"Looks like there were some issues with your render job. We recieved the following errors:
Missing assets - Export your scene to OctaneRender Standalone Edition as an Animated ORBX."

Which is exactly what I did.
I also did a test without the material sequence in the orbx file and it works great.
I also unpacked my orbx that contains the material sequence and all the requested file are in it.


What should I do?

I am having this same issue. I have a basic c4d scene with an animated texture from a MOV file. I've exported it as an Animated Package to the standalone and it works fine, I can see the animation in the standalone.
However when I upload it to ORC and get back this same error.

What should I being doing differently?

Thanks

EDIT/Solution:
This problem only seems to occur when uploading through the standalone. If I upload the Orbx that came from c4d straight to ORC it works
